I had a go at building openjump version 1-2-D with ecj, but ran into a few missing classes.
The problematic ones are com.ermapper.ecw, javax.media.jai, de.fho.jump.pirol.utilities and org.jmat. Do these classes exist in Debian? There is also a problem with the use of com.sun.image.codec.jpeg.JPEGDecodeParam. This is the code in question: RenderedOp image = null; [...] image = FileLoadDescriptor.create(file.getPath(),null,null,null) [...] int jpg_colorspace = image.getColorModel().getColorSpace().getType(); if (jpg_colorspace != JPEGDecodeParam.COLOR_ID_GRAY) Is there an easy way to replace this with code that work with GNU Classpath?
